The Private Client Group - Americas (“PCG”) is part of the Investor Relations Team that is responsible for the fundraising activities of the Firm. PCG focuses on delivering HarbourVest’s private markets solutions to the private wealth market primarily through financial intermediaries including wire-houses, regional broker-dealers, private banks, multi-family offices and registered investment advisors.

The Private Client Group is responsible for the distribution of HarbourVest products the private wealth channel in the US, Canada and Latin America.

This role will be focused on raising capital in the US - Midwest region by developing and maintaining relationships with financial advisors in the Wire-House/Private Bank, RIA, and Family Office channels in the specified region to drive sales and AUM growth across private and registered funds.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
